Many pregnant women often suffer from ectopic pregnancy, and many women do not find out until the diagnosis is confirmed. Ectopic pregnancy is an acute abdominal disease in obstetrics and gynecology. Knowing the early symptoms of ectopic pregnancy can help detect ectopic pregnancy in time. So what are the early symptoms of ectopic pregnancy ? The following is a detailed answer from relevant experts. 1. 90% of patients will experience abdominal pain, which is often manifested as severe sudden pain, tearing or cutting, because the intra-abdominal bleeding stimulates the peritoneum. Severe bleeding may be accompanied by dizziness, blurred vision and even shock, manifested as pale complexion, cold limbs, anal swelling and defecation sensation. Some abdominal pain extends to the whole body and can cause nausea, shoulder pain, etc. This is an early symptom of ectopic pregnancy. 2. 70-80% of patients have a history of amenorrhea, mostly for 6-8 weeks. Some have no history of amenorrhea, or mistake abnormal vaginal bleeding for menstruation, which often leads to misdiagnosis. Special attention should be paid to this. 3. As the fertilized egg develops in the narrow cavity of the fallopian tube, it will be blocked after reaching a certain degree, and the embryo will slowly die, which will manifest as irregular vaginal bleeding, the amount is often less than the menstrual amount, and the duration is also longer. This is also an early symptom of ectopic pregnancy. The above is an introduction to the early symptoms of ectopic pregnancy.
